Your Role:
The District Manager is responsible for managing 3-8 restaurants. Primary duties and responsibilities include:
- Supervise, train, and coach restaurant managers: Build a strong, positive, and fun work environment where team members are trained and coached to meet their potential
- Strong adherence to SOP’s: Ability to coach team in a positive and timely manner to comply with SOP’s and meet company standards
- Manage the Area P&L statement, and work with GM’s to take corrective actions as needed to meet or beat budget targets
- Ensure food is of the highest quality, training teams to provide outstanding guest service
- Meet or exceed all health and safety standards
